Overview of Gardroid

Gardroid is a widely popular gardening app that offers a wide range of features to help gardeners plan, track, and manage their vegetable gardens. One of the key features of Gardroid is its extensive plant database, which provides users with detailed information on a wide variety of vegetables, fruits, and herbs. This database includes essential growing information such as planting times, watering needs, and harvesting periods, making it easier for users to successfully cultivate their crops.

Pros of using Gardroid include its user-friendly interface, which makes it easy for both beginner and experienced gardeners to navigate the app. Additionally, Gardroid offers customizable reminders for important gardening tasks like watering and fertilizing plants, helping users stay on top of their garden maintenance. The app also allows users to track their garden’s progress by inputting data on plant growth, yields, and harvest dates.

However, there are some cons to consider when using Gardroid. Some users have reported that the app’s database does not include every plant variety they were looking for, potentially limiting its usefulness for certain gardeners. Additionally, while Gardroid offers a free version with basic features, more advanced functionality is only available through a paid subscription.

In summary, Gardroid presents itself as a comprehensive tool for managing vegetable gardens with its extensive plant database and user-friendly interface. However, potential users should consider the limitations of its plant database and the necessity of a paid subscription for full access to its features.

Overview of Gardenize

Gardenize is a gardening app that aims to help users plan, record, and manage their garden activities. One of the key features of Gardenize is its ability to help users keep track of what they have planted and when, allowing them to better plan for the future. This app also allows users to create digital garden notebooks, which can be useful for keeping track of plant care routines and schedules.

Some of the pros of using Gardenize include its intuitive user interface and ease of navigation. The app is designed in a way that makes it easy for both beginner and experienced gardeners to use. Additionally, Gardenize offers customization options, allowing users to personalize their digital gardening notebooks to suit their specific needs and preferences.

However, there are also some cons associated with Gardenize. One such disadvantage is that some advanced features may only be available through a subscription model, which can be off-putting for those who prefer free apps or one-time purchases. Additionally, some users may find the initial setup process to be time-consuming, especially if they have a large garden with many different plants and areas to manage.

Overall, Gardenize is a comprehensive gardening app that offers useful features for planning and tracking garden activities. While it may not be completely free or without some drawbacks like any other app in this category like Gardroid vs My Vegetable Garden, it can certainly be a valuable tool for individuals looking to stay organized and on top of their gardening tasks.

Comparison of Gardenize and My Vegetable Garden

When it comes to choosing a gardening app, functionality, tracking features, and customization options play a crucial role in determining which app best suits your needs. In this section, we will compare the functionalities, tracking features, and customization options of Gardenize and My Vegetable Garden to help you make an informed decision.

Functionality

Gardenize offers a wide range of functionalities designed to cater to all aspects of gardening. With features such as plant inventory management, task lists, weather and climate zone information, and note-taking capabilities, Gardenize provides comprehensive support for gardeners of all levels. On the other hand, My Vegetable Garden focuses specifically on vegetable gardening, offering functionalities tailored to the specific needs of growing vegetables. Users can track planting dates, harvests, and specific care instructions for various vegetable plants.

Tracking Features

In terms of tracking features, both Gardenize and My Vegetable Garden excel in providing users with the tools they need to monitor their garden’s progress. Gardenize allows users to track plant inventory, store photos and notes for each plant or area in the garden.



Additionally, Gardenize offers a journal feature that enables users to record daily observations and thoughts about their garden. Meanwhile, My Vegetable Garden provides specialized tracking features for vegetable gardens such as monitoring seed sowing dates, transplanting dates, and harvesting schedules.

Customization Options

When it comes to customization options, both apps offer different levels of flexibility. Gardenize allows users to customize their garden layouts virtually by adding borders or creating different zones within their gardens. It also offers the ability to add notes and photos for each individual plant entry. On the other hand, My Vegetable Garden focuses more on tailoring its functionalities specifically for cultivating vegetables rather than providing extensive customization options like virtual layout designs.

What Is the Best App to Track the Sun for Gardening?

When it comes to tracking the sun for gardening, one of the best apps available is “Sun Seeker.” This app uses augmented reality to show the path of the sun throughout the day at any location. It helps gardeners plan their garden layout and optimize sunlight exposure for their plants.
